This print captures Lorenzo Veneziano's masterpiece, "Madonna and Child Enthroned with Two Donors" created around 1360-65. The altarpiece showcases the profound bond between the Virgin Mary and baby Jesus, surrounded by two generous patrons who kneel in reverence. Veneziano's meticulous attention to detail is evident in this stunning artwork. The golden background illuminates the scene, highlighting the regal throne on which Madonna and Child are seated. Their radiant presence is further enhanced by intricate gold leaf accents that adorn their garments. The artist skillfully portrays a tender moment of motherhood as Mary cradles her divine child with utmost love and care. Meanwhile, two adorable cherubic angels hover above them, adding an ethereal touch to the composition. Notably, perched delicately on Mary's hand is a vibrant Goldfinch (Carduelis elegans), symbolizing Christ's future crucifixion and resurrection. This subtle yet powerful religious reference adds depth to the painting's narrative. The inclusion of animal motifs such as ermine fur also reflects Renaissance symbolism associated with purity and nobility. Displayed at The Metropolitan Museum of Art, this medieval masterpiece continues to captivate viewers with its rich colors and timeless beauty. It serves as a testament to Lorenzo Veneziano’s artistic prowess while offering us a glimpse into Italy’s cultural heritage during the 14th century.
